Natural killer cells and nitric oxide.

M G Cifone1, S Ulisse, A Santoni

  • 1Department of Experimental Medicine, University of L'Aquila, Italy. cifone@univaq.it

International Immunopharmacology
|August 23, 2001
PubMed
Summary

Natural killer (NK) cells and nitric oxide (NO) work together in the innate immune response. Nitric oxide (NO) is essential for NK cell-mediated killing and regulates NK cell activation.

Area of Science:

  • Immunology
  • Cellular Biology

Background:

  • Natural killer (NK) cells are lymphocytes crucial for innate immunity, identifying and eliminating infected or tumor cells.
  • NK cells distinguish 'self' from 'non-self' via receptors recognizing MHC class I determinants.
  • Cytokines like IL-2 and IL-12 enhance NK cell activity, which is linked to nitric oxide (NO) synthesis.

Purpose of the Study:

  • To review evidence for nitric oxide (NO) as a mediator and regulator of NK cell function.
  • To discuss findings from NO synthase gene deletion studies.
  • To compare rodent and human NK cells.

Main Methods:

  • Review of existing scientific literature.
  • Analysis of studies involving NO synthesis inhibitors.
  • Examination of NO synthase gene deletion studies.

Main Results:

  • Inhibitors of NO synthesis reduce NK cell-mediated killing, confirming NO's role in this process.
  • NO itself can modulate NK cell activation.
  • Evidence suggests NO is both a mediator of NK cell cytotoxicity and a regulator of NK cell activity.

Conclusions:

  • Nitric oxide (NO) plays a dual role in NK cell function, acting as both a mediator of target cell killing and a regulator of NK cell activation.
  • Further research, including gene deletion studies, supports the critical involvement of NO in innate immunity.
  • Comparative studies of rodent and human NK cells are important for understanding species-specific immune responses.
